Problem H: 散步

"
Time Limit $1$ 秒/Second(s) Memory Limit $512$ 兆字节/Megabyte(s)
提交总数 $15$ 正确数量 $14$
裁判形式 标准裁判/Standard Judge 我的状态 尚未尝试
难度 分类标签 图论 搜索
⑨每天吃完晚饭后都会从家出发到雾之湖及其周围去散步下,最终到达魔法森林的入口,并且尽可能尝试不同的路径。雾之湖及其周围可以抽象为一个矩形,划分为n*m块区域,⑨家为(1,1),散步时⑨在某个区域会逗留一段时间,然后移动到东西南北相邻的其中一个格子(移动时间忽略不计),经过若干次移动最终到达魔法森林(n,m)。因为是散步,所以起点和终点⑨都会逗留一段时间。⑨表示虽然是闲逛,但是也不能太浪费时间,还是得去终点(n,m)的,所以只有至少存在一条从B到终点的时间比从A到终点的所有路径所花费的时间更少时才可以从A到B。现在⑨想知道自己一共有多少种路径可以选择,因为⑨的智商只有⑨,她自己肯定没法算出来啦。你能帮帮⑨吗?
本体有多组数据。每组数据第一行为n,m(2<=n,m<=50) 接下来为n行m列的矩阵,表示在每个区域⑨逗留的时间t(0<=t<=1000)。
每组数据输出一行,表示路径总数(保证小于2^63)。
3 3
1 2 3
1 2 3
1 2 3
3 3
1 1 1
1 1 1
1 1 1
1
6